Belize Weather Forecast: May 3, 2021


General Situation:
Ambergris Caye: Conditions this morning by Elbert just before or after this post!
Belize NMS: Present Condition: Mostly clear skies, a few clouds in the south and west. Clear and very windy in San Pedro, a little bit hazy. Hot and mostly dry weather conditions prevail.
Advisories: A small craft caution is in effect for occasional gusty winds and rough seas at times in large north to northeasterly waves. HEAT ALERT: Residents, especially those living in the interior of the country, are advised to stay hydrated and avoid outdoor activities as much as possible.
24-hour forecast: Mostly sunny and very hot today, with showers if any being isolated and brief. Clear to partly cloudy tonight with little or no rainfall.
Winds: E-SE, 10-20 kts
Sea State: Moderate - Rough
Waves: 5-8 ft.
Sea Surface Temperature (°f): 84
Outlook: For Tuesday and Tuesday night is for continuing hot and mostly dry weather. Showers, if any, will be isolated.
Sargassum Forecast from April 27 to May 5: The chances of sargassum affecting coastal areas will remain high during the next few days. San Pedro has a high probability and a major impact.
Tropical Weather Outlook: There are no organized tropical features across the Atlantic basin at this time. Updates will resume at the beginning of the 2021 hurricane season (June 1). Click for more...

The Caribbean Sea

A mid-level ridge over the Bahamas and Greater Antilles is producing subsidence and very dry air over the Caribbean Sea north of 13N, as shown by GOES-16 water vapor channels. In the SW Caribbean, satellite imagery shows scattered moderate showers and tstorms south of 12N between 75W-84W. Some showers also persist in the far SE Caribbean between Bonaire and the southern Windward Islands.

Earlier ASCAT data indicated fresh to strong E to SE winds in the Gulf of Honduras, with moderate to fresh trade winds elsewhere. Seas are 3-5 ft across most of the basin, except 5-8 ft in the Gulf of Honduras and 1-3 ft south of Cuba and in the far SW Caribbean.

For the forecast, fresh to strong SE trade winds will continue in the Gulf of Honduras through Wed night due to the pressure gradient between the Atlantic ridge and lower pressures over Central America. Moderate to fresh E trades will continue elsewhere across the basin through at least Fri night.
